What is a 401(k) Rollover Gold IRA?


A 401(k) rollover Gold IRA is a retirement account that allows individuals to transfer funds from their existing 401(k) plans into a self-directed IRA that holds physical gold and other precious metals. The Process of Rolling Over a 401(k) into a Gold IRA


Rolling over a 401(k) into a Gold IRA involves several steps. Here’s a breakdown of the process:
Choose a Custodian: The first step is to select a reputable custodian who specializes in Gold IRAs. This custodian will manage your account and ensure compliance with IRS regulations.

Open a Gold IRA Account: Once you have chosen a custodian, you will need to open a self-directed Gold IRA account. This process typically involves filling out an application and providing identification.

Initiate the Rollover: Contact your 401(k) plan administrator to initiate the rollover process. They will provide you with the necessary paperwork to transfer your funds. You can choose a direct rollover, where the funds are transferred directly from your 401(k) to your Gold IRA, or an indirect rollover, where you receive a check and must deposit it into your Gold IRA within 60 days.

Select Your Precious Metals: After the funds are in your Gold IRA, you can begin selecting the types of precious metals you wish to invest in. The IRS has specific guidelines regarding the types of gold and other metals that are eligible for inclusion in a Gold IRA. Generally, only certain bullion coins and bars that meet minimum purity standards are allowed.

Purchase and Store the Metals: Once you have made your selections, your custodian will facilitate the purchase of the metals on your behalf. It is important to note that physical gold must be stored in an approved depository to comply with IRS regulations. Your custodian can help you find a secure storage solution.

Important Considerations


While rolling over a 401(k) into a Gold IRA can offer several benefits, there are important considerations to keep in mind:
Fees: Gold IRAs often come with higher fees compared to traditional IRAs due to the costs associated with purchasing, storing, and insuring physical gold. Be sure to understand all associated fees before proceeding.

Investment Risks: Like any investment, gold carries risks. The price of gold can be volatile, and there is no guarantee of returns. It is essential to conduct thorough research and consider your risk tolerance before investing.

IRS Regulations: The IRS has strict regulations regarding Gold IRAs, including the types of metals that can be held and the storage requirements. Ensure that your custodian is knowledgeable about these regulations to avoid potential penalties.
